Difference Between Buying Electric Trailer Brake Kit Set Versus Buying Each Brake Individually
Question:
$2 More expensive than buying individual L and R? Whats the difference?
asked by: Bill
0
Expert Reply:
Electric Trailer Brake Kit # AKEBRK-35-SA comes with both the right and left brake assemblies but also new nuts and washers. If you get the brakes individually the nuts and washers are sold separately. If you do not need the nuts and washers then getting the brakes by themselves # AKEBRK-35L-SA and # AKEBRK-35R-SA would safe you a little bit.
